Peach tree trimming services involve carefully shaping and maintaining the health of peach trees through precise pruning techniques. This process typically includes removing dead, damaged, or diseased branches, as well as thinning out crowded areas to allow better airflow and sunlight penetration. Proper trimming encourages stronger growth, improves fruit production, and helps prevent issues like branch breakage or pest infestations. Service providers experienced in peach tree trimming understand the specific needs of these fruit trees and can tailor their work to support healthy development and optimal harvests.

Many problems can be addressed through professional peach tree trimming. Overgrown or unruly branches can hinder fruit production and make trees more susceptible to disease. Excessive growth can also lead to weak branches that are prone to breaking under the weight of fruit or storm conditions. Additionally, poorly maintained trees may produce smaller or fewer peaches, affecting both yield and quality. Regular trimming by trained contractors can help mitigate these issues, promoting stronger, more productive trees and reducing the likelihood of costly damage or disease spread.

Homeowners may need peach tree trimming services when trees show signs of overgrowth, such as tangled branches or excessive shading, which can hinder fruit production. Other indicators include the presence of dead or broken branches, or if the tree’s canopy becomes too dense, limiting airflow. Regular trimming can also prevent problems like pests or fungal diseases that thrive in crowded, unventilated branches. What are the benefits of trimming peach trees? Regular trimming helps improve fruit production, maintain tree health, and promote better air circulation around the branches.

When is the best time to trim peach trees? The ideal time for trimming peach trees is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

How do local contractors ensure proper peach tree trimming? Experienced service providers use proper pruning techniques to shape the tree, remove dead or diseased branches, and encourage healthy growth.

Can trimming help prevent pests and diseases in peach trees? Yes, proper pruning can improve airflow and reduce the risk of pest infestations and disease development.

What tools do local pros typically use for peach tree trimming? They commonly use pruning shears, loppers, and saws to carefully trim branches and maintain the tree's shape.
